Pro-Xylane is a popular cosmetic skincare ingredient most often used for its anti-aging, hydrating, and skin restructuring benefits. It’s a synthetic derivative of a natural sugar (xylose) developed with green chemistry and widely incorporated into premium skincare products.
What Pro-Xylane Is
- A biomimetic sugar-molecule active (INCI: Hydroxypropyl Tetrahydropyrantriol) developed by L’Oréal R&D.
- Designed to mimic and stimulate components of the skin’s structural matrix, especially proteoglycans and glycosaminoglycans (GAGs) which help retain moisture and support skin firmness.

Main Uses of Pro-Xylane
1. Anti-Aging / Wrinkle Reduction
- Pro-Xylane is most commonly used in anti-aging skincare to reduce visible signs of aging, such as fine lines and wrinkles. It helps increase the production of structural molecules like proteoglycans and collagen precursors, which support skin firmness and elasticity.
2. Hydration and Moisture Retention
- It’s effective at enhancing deep skin hydration by increasing the skin’s ability to hold water, leading to a plumper, smoother, and more supple appearance.
3. Improves Skin Elasticity & Firmness
- By stimulating synthesis of elements such as GAGs and supporting the extracellular matrix, Pro-Xylane can improve skin elasticity and structural integrity, making skin look firmer and more youthful.
4. Strengthens Skin Barrier
- It supports a healthier skin barrier, which helps prevent moisture loss and protect against environmental stressors.
5. Smoothing and Texture Enhancement
- Long-term use may lead to smoother, more even skin texture and overall healthier-looking skin.
6. Brightening Appearance
- By improving hydration and texture, Pro-Xylane can also contribute to a brighter, more radiant complexion.
Where You’ll Find Pro-Xylane
This ingredient is commonly formulated into a range of skincare products, including:
- Anti-aging serums and creams
- Hydrating moisturizers
- Firming and lifting treatments
- Eye creams
- Barrier repair formulas
- Sheet masks and rich emulsions

Additional Notes
- Gentle & well tolerated — usually suitable for most skin types, including sensitive skin.
- Works well with other actives like hyaluronic acid, ceramides, and peptides.
- Not a drug — benefits are cosmetic and may vary by product formulation.
